>
> static inline void relay_set_buf_dentry(struct rchan_buf *buf,
> struct dentry *dentry)
> {
> buf->dentry = dentry;
> d_inode(buf->dentry)->i_size = buf->early_bytes; <--
> }
>
> Doing a bisect landed on this:
>
> ff9fb72bc07705c00795ca48631f7fffe24d2c6b ("debugfs: return error
> values, not NULL")
>
> If I revert this patch, I can't reproduce any more. I don't see a
> relationship, though...
>
> My crash appears as:
> [ 121.934378] BUG: unable to handle kernel NULL pointer dereference
> at 0000000000000047
> [ 121.937187] #PF error: [normal kernel read fault]
> [ 121.938824] PGD 800000041f699067 P4D 800000041f699067 PUD 42d08f067 PMD 0
> [ 121.941166] Oops: 0000 [#1] SMP PTI
> [ 121.942381] CPU: 2 PID: 3134 Comm: relay Not tainted
> 5.0.0-rc4-next-20190130 #1020
> [ 121.943873] Hardware name: QEMU Standard PC (i440FX + PIIX, 1996),
> BIOS 1.10.2-1ubuntu1 04/01/2014
> [ 121.945395] RIP: 0010:relay_open_buf.part.10+0x2b8/0x330
> ...
> [ 121.960021] Call Trace:
> [ 121.960453] relay_open+0x18e/0x2c0
> [ 121.961070] __blk_trace_setup+0x1af/0x350
> [ 121.961777] blk_trace_ioctl+0x93/0x100
>
>
> $ ./scripts/faddr2line vmlinux relay_open_buf.part.10+0x2b8/0x330
> relay_open_buf.part.10+0x2b8/0x330:
> relay_set_buf_dentry at kernel/relay.c:412
> (inlined by) relay_open_buf at kernel/relay.c:458
>
> So it's the same location, but not sure about 0x47 offset. d_inode is
> 0x58 from dentry. And i_size is 0x50 from inode. If this isn't NULL,
> but rather an ERR_PTR, the errno is either:
>
> EBADF 9 Bad file descriptor
> EEXIST 17 File exists
>
> Neither are used in the debugfs patch, but debugfs is clearly used in
> do_blk_trace_setup():
>
> if (!blk_debugfs_root)
> return -ENOENT;
> ...
> dir = debugfs_lookup(buts->name, blk_debugfs_root);
> if (!dir)
> bt->dir = dir = debugfs_create_dir(buts->name,
> blk_debugfs_root);
> if (!dir)
> goto err;
> ...
> bt->rchan = relay_open("trace", dir, buts->buf_size,
> buts->buf_nr, &blk_relay_callbacks, bt);
>
> Which is confirmed by the next line in my traceback:
>
> $ ./scripts/faddr2line vmlinux __blk_trace_setup+0x1af/0x350
> __blk_trace_setup+0x1af/0x350:
> do_blk_trace_setup at kernel/trace/blktrace.c:534
> (inlined by) __blk_trace_setup at kernel/trace/blktrace.c:577
Can you test the patch below?
thanks,
greg k-h
--------------
diff --git a/kernel/relay.c b/kernel/relay.c
index 04f248644e06..9e0f52375487 100644
--- a/kernel/relay.c
+++ b/kernel/relay.c
@@ -428,6 +428,8 @@ static struct dentry *relay_create_buf_file(struct rchan *chan,
dentry = chan->cb->create_buf_file(tmpname, chan->parent,
S_IRUSR, buf,
&chan->is_global);
+ if (IS_ERR(dentry))
+ dentry = NULL;
kfree(tmpname);
@@ -461,7 +463,7 @@ static struct rchan_buf *relay_open_buf(struct rchan *chan, unsigned int cpu)
dentry = chan->cb->create_buf_file(NULL, NULL,
S_IRUSR, buf,
&chan->is_global);
- if (WARN_ON(dentry))
+ if (IS_ERR_OR_NULL(dentry))
goto free_buf;
}
